Product Introduction

 

A high-linearity mixer with integrated LO is an RF device that incorporates a local oscillator in the RF signal processing chain to achieve low-distortion frequency conversion.

 

 

Product Parameters

 


BR9133EA

 

Frequency

1.0GHz~3.5GHz

Conversion loss

7.5dB

IP1dB

18dBm

IIP3

26dBm

Supply current

5V Single Power Supply;36mA

LO Power

0dBm

Package

EMSOP8
